Is there a minimum age for signing a professional contract?

Yes there is, you can't sign a professional contract before your 17th birthday.

If however he is offered a pro contract by Birmingham and rejects it then Birmingham would be due compensation which, if not agreed between the two clubs would then be set by the Professional Football Compensation Committee

Jadon Sancho is an example of a player moving between clubs before signing a pro contract ...

'Sancho joined Watford at the age of seven.[11] Due to issues with commuting across London to the club's academy, he moved into accommodation provided by Watford and began attending their partner school Harefield Academy as a boarder, aged 11.

At the age of 14, he moved to Manchester City in March 2015 for an initial fee of £66,000 under the EPPP, potentially rising to £500,000 with add ons'
